Avjiaduo is a transliterated name from the Italian word "Affogato", which translates to "inundation". It is said that it means to concentrate and drown ice cream, which is really appropriate. But there is a huge controversy about Alfjado: should it be a coffee dessert or a coffee drink?
Because it is based on the idea of espresso, most Italian cafes will think that it should be regarded as a coffee drink. But the solid ice cream requires it to be eaten with a spoon, so there is a debate over the classification of desserts or drinks. Although the controversy does exist, there is a consensus on the way Avjiaduo is eaten. When digging for ice cream, it will be dug up and eaten together with espresso that has sunk to the bottom of the cup. In this way, in the sweetness of a large number of ice cream, it will be sandwiched with concentrated mellow bitterness, two very different flavors to create a sense of conflict, like the finishing touch, amazing!
The ice cream used by traditional Afjiadow is vanilla flavor, fresh vanilla flavor can neutralize concentrated bitterness, compared with other flavors, it will be more suitable. Espresso is usually extracted with deeply roasted beans because it better highlights the sweetness of ice cream. The production ratio of Avjiaduo is also very simple. The ratio of ice cream to concentrate is 1:1. Prepare an ice cream ball in the cup, and then prepare an extra milk cup to hold the espresso. When you use it, you only need to pour the concentrate directly on it. It's very simple.

In the taste of eating, the ice cream will partially melt because it is watered with warm concentration, and the melted ice cream will blend with the concentrate, making the coffee taste more mellow and bitter more mild! Because of the addition of concentrated ice cream, it increases the sense of conflict, so that people can feel a completely different quality experience!
What is mentioned in the front street above is only the classic version of Afujiaduo. With the changes of the times, the recipe of Afujiaduo will also change because of the local culture! For example, squeeze chocolate sauce and caramel sauce on ice cream, or sprinkle cocoa powder and cinnamon powder to increase aroma; you can also add nuts, cookies, berries and other materials to increase the level of experience.
